Transaction 38c50a7061e936494a9e5040cf6d43ec537b446603e6698e10581f175b2a02d2
1 Input
1 Output
-
38c50a7061e936494a9e5040cf6d43ec537b446603e6698e10581f175b2a02d2:0
- value
- 4929223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d3739f448ec9c53c60702b452cbb9db5c84f83a OP_EQUAL
- address
- 3Qmu3GoWXSCdWEdADDoGYksPzUu4LP5FAJ